A quality pair of jeans can see shoppers through numerous fashion seasons and go with everything. And a new pair from Marks & Spencer has been hailed by shoppers for the flattering fit.
The M&S 16Arlington pure cotton high waisted wide leg jeans are part of an exclusive range created in collaboration with cult London label 16Arlington. They’re priced at £65 and have a high-waist cut, falling into a wide leg that reaches ankle length. Made from 100% cotton for structure and to maintain their shape without clinging. The cut means they’re great if you want a nice pair of jeans that will fit nicely around the stomach and flatter the waistline.
Available in both short and regular lengths, and in sizes 6 to 18, these jeans feature a clean and understated wash. According to M&S, the jeans are one of the collection’s best-selling items and have been bought more than 100 times in the last five days.
Shoppers can accentuate the high waist by tucking in a white T-shirt or fine knit, and add loafers or low-heeled boots to elongate the leg and perfectly complement the dark indigo colour. These jeans can be washed at 40C and feature a button and zip fastening at the waist, reports the Mirror.
As the jeans are a new addition to the M&S website, they don’t have any customer reviews. However, the brand is known for it’s good quality denim.
A similar pair of jeans, in terms of cut, is the High Waisted Wide Leg Ankle Grazer Jeans. In reviews, shoppers have described these jeans as « comfortable and soft ». That said, the 16Arlington jeans are a little pricier than your usual M&S pair (because they’re a designer collaboration).
M&S jeans usually retail somewhere between £30 and £45, whereas the 16arlington jeans are £65. However, for a big designer name, £65 is a fantastic price.
